Transaction 30efb235cf697b28dd67c01dc0f8a2198d5d747930611615d79aaf1e7de9f780
1 Input
1 Output
-
30efb235cf697b28dd67c01dc0f8a2198d5d747930611615d79aaf1e7de9f780:0
- value
- 1508959
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d38234f72e189b9fe64ea23248016497eb37a33
- address
- bc1qd5uzxnmjuxymnlnyag3jfqqkf9ltx73ne3wrmx